about

Sublime re-working of Sam Cooke's classic protest song by Youthsayers - our talented and hardworking group of South London teenagers, working with limited resources in lockdown isolation. A testament to positivity, strength in community and hope for the future.

Recorded individually at home during lockdown, this track represents Youthsayers' determination to continue to make uplifiting and positive sounds despite the current challenges.

Sam Cooke's remarkable civil rights era protest song (originally edited by his own label to avoid the controversy) is treated with a heavy reggae groove, sublime vocals and heartfelt playing all round by our group of talented teenagers - a song of hope, defiance and triumph over adversity and opression. Sadly all too relevant in today's political and social climate, but offering joy and the promise of a better future in the certain knowledge that A Change Is Gonna Come.

Thanks for your support. All proceeds go to the continuation of Youthsayers as a freely accessible community music project for 9-20 year olds in the Brixton area.

soothsayers London, UK

Soothsayers have been in their SW2 studio producing their wide reaching sonic reflection of the locality which draws together the local raw materials of 24 carat dub, afro-beat, and deep-funk in compelling style.

Influences are wide ranging and numerous but The Wailers, Fela, Lee ‘Scratch’ Perry, Skatalites, The Specials, Masakela ,Roots Manuva, Massive Attack, King Tubby should not be ignored.
